When looking for the cheapest target-date funds, the usual suspects usually top the list. Vanguard, Schwab, Fidelity and TIAA are all well-known for their broad menus of low-cost fund choices, so seeing them offering the least-expensive TDFs should come as no surprise. The king of low-cost index funds is a natural choice for one of the best target date mutual fund families. Vanguard's target retirement funds average 0.12% expenses, whereas the average target date fund averages 0.55%. Oct 14, 2021 · Save $6,000 a year in a target date fund for 30 years that charges 0.10% and you will have around $590,000 assuming a gross annualized return of 7%. A “to” fund is designed to get you to that target date. The fund will be at its most conservative then and hold that allocation forever. The idea is that the investor in the target-date “to” fund will use the pot of savings all at once or transfer to another vehicle for continued income generation.
